In Group 2, Malta will host the Faroe Islands, Georgia and Armenia whilst FYR Macedonia welcomes Luxembourg, Lithuania, and Latvia.
The two group winners progress to join the 36 entrants with the highest coefficients in the main qualifying round draw on the 14th of March.
That stage, with four groups of five teams and three of six, will run from September 2011 to September 2012. The group winners and best runners-up will join hosts Sweden in the finals from the 10th to the 28th of July 2013 along with the winners in three two-legged play-offs held between the other second-placed teams in October 2012.
